About this earthquake

A magnitude M3.3 earthquake was recorded near MOLUCCA SEA (Indonesia) on December 29, 2025 at 07:24 UTC. With a focal depth of about 17 km, this was a shallow earthquake, whose shaking is usually felt more strongly at the surface. Shaking of this size is frequently noticed but usually harmless.

The event was recorded by EMSC. Indonesia: over the past 24 hours, QuakeMap24 logged 83 earthquakes, the strongest at M4.9.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
